Output 62f3abbacf408e3f6a2ca4ebdbc0d03b68cb2e8a26b55bfdfecdd00b377277b7:1

value
1122393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ea3e91b3ea082a2d833c9231c492bd6726f2f9b OP_EQUAL
address
3DEdRRM6m4PGndA11aYgyxBGzSceaZRyLh
transaction
62f3abbacf408e3f6a2ca4ebdbc0d03b68cb2e8a26b55bfdfecdd00b377277b7
confirmations
156260
spent
true